About this fabric

This colourway in the Senso collection has the look of warm burnt wood and clay, with a muted red-brown depth that feels grounded rather than bright. The 74% virgin wool and 26% silk composition gives the cloth a refined, lightly lustrous finish, while the plain, texture-led surface keeps the appearance clean and contemporary. With no repeat and an approximate width of 142cm, it is straightforward to cut and use on larger upholstered pieces. The Q 8 + T 3 care code and √BM fire code support its use in practical residential schemes.

How to use it

Use it on a sofa, banquette or occasional chair where the warm terracotta tone can anchor paler linens and natural woods. It also works well with aged brass, tobacco leather and soft neutral walls for a richly layered scheme.
